Sen. Elizabeth Warren Joins Calls To Replace ICE: 'This Is Ugly, This Is Wrong.'

Source: Mediaite

Sen. Elizabeth Warren (D-MA) joined the growing calls to reimagine and replace Immigrations and Customs Enforcement.

Speaking at an immigration rally in Boston on Saturday afternoon, Warren told demonstrators that the current immigration situation is “ugly” and “wrong.”

“This is ugly, this is wrong, and this is not the way to run our country,” Warren said. “The president’s deeply immoral actions have made it obvious we need to rebuild our immigration system from top to bottom starting by replacing ICE with something that reflects our morality and values.”

She added: “This moment is a moral crisis for our country.” Warren is one of a growing number of lawmakers calling for ICE to be replaced or reformed, starting with Sen. Kirsten Gillibrand (D-NY), who claimed ICE has become a “deportation force.”...


Read more: https://www.msn.com/en-us/news/politics/sen-elizabeth-warren-joins-calls-to-replace-ice-%e2%80%98this-is-ugly-this-is-wrong%e2%80%99/ar-AAzoywu?li=BBnbcA1



Sens. Bernie Sanders (I-Vt.) and Kamala Harris (D-Calif.) have also spoken out against ICE and called for the agency to be reformed, but not abolished entirely.

'More Than A Dozen Ice Agents Call For Agency To Be Disbanded. In letter to Kirstjen Nielsen, 19 agents say immigration crackdown makes it difficult to investigate significant national security issues.' The Guardian, June 29, 2018.

Nineteen senior investigators at the US Immigration and Customs Enforcement (Ice) have called for the law enforcement agency, responsible for both national security investigations and deportation of undocumented migrants, to be disbanded.
In a letter to the homeland security secretary, Kirstjen Nielsen, the 19 agents express concern that Donald Trump’s hardline crackdown on undocumented migrants has made it harder for them to conduct effective investigations into significant national security issues.

The sprawling federal law enforcement agency, which employs more than 20,000 people, is split into two primary divisions: enforcement and removal operations (ERO) focused on deportations, and homeland security investigations (HSI) focused on national security investigations into areas including drugs and arms trafficking.

The 19 investigators, all from the HSI division, wrote that their investigations, “have been perceived as targeting undocumented aliens, instead of the transnational criminal organizations that facilitate cross border crimes impacting our communities and national security”.
The letter continues: “Furthermore, the perception of HSI’s investigative independence is unnecessarily impacted by the political nature of ERO’s civil immigration enforcement.” It adds that certain local jurisdictions in America have refused to work with HSI because of a “perceived linkage” to deportations.

The agents suggest splitting Ice into two separate agencies...The letter is likely to bolster the growing movement in Democratic politics and activist circles to abolish Ice. In recent days a number of high-profile Democrats, including the New York City mayor, Bill de Blasio, and New York senator Kirsten Gillibrand, have called for the agency to be disbanded with a new immigration enforcement program brought in in its place...The calls are unlikely to sway Donald Trump who, since assuming office, has taken extraordinary measures to bolster the agency’s powers.
